The Southeast Georgia Health System Wellness on Wheels (WOW) is custom designed to make breast health care services conveniently accessible for all women in southeast Georgia. It is a completely self-contained mobile health vehicle that features digital mammography and travels to rural locations in Brantley, Camden, Glynn, Long and McIntosh counties to offer breast imaging services.

The screening experience on the WOW is very similar to any of the Health System Imaging locations: it’s staffed by female mammography technologists specially trained to perform breast imaging; all mammograms are read by Health System radiologists; most insurances are accepted; and, financial assistance is available to patients who qualify.
